Share: Title:Clash Royale MEMES #91 Duration: 4:54 Plays: 5.7K views Published: 11 hours ago Download MP3 Download MP4 Simillar Videos ▶️ 4:31 Clash Royale Memes #90 5.7K views • 7 days ago ▶️ 3:45 Evolved Electro-wizard Ultimate Clash Royale Funny Moments Glitches Memes #64 5.7K views • 6 months ago ▶️ 4:26 Clash Royale Memes #83 5.7K views • 1 month ago ▶️ 4:52 Clash Royale Memes #88 5.7K views • 3 weeks ago